Ok, I read the CanCan documentation more carefully and this jumped out 
the screen...
"This will fetch the project using Project.find(params[:project_id]) on 
every controller action, save it in the @project instance variable..."

When I was going to /users the companies resource was empty and it would 
throw the Access Denied error unless I used shallow nesting (:shallow => 
true).

So I should've been going to /companies/45/users instead. Then companies 
get loaded as well as users. My problem with this is that it can only 
display users from a certain company.
